DYNAMOMETER

Definition  A dynamometer is a device which measure accurately the cutting forces encountered during the cutting process.  In most metal cutting dynamometers the total force is determined by measuring,during metal cutting,the deflection or strain in the elements supporting the cutting tool & dynamometer design should be such that it gives strains or displacement large enough to be measured accurately  Dynamometer is designed such that it measures all the three components in a set of rectangular co-ordinate. While measuring these three forces,the dynamometer should be designed that force in X-direction should give no reading in Y & Z direction

DIFFERENT TOOL DYNAMOMETERS COMMONLY USED ARE : 1.MECHANICAL DIAL GAUGE TYPE 2.STRAIN GUAGE TYPE

MECHANICAL DIAL GAUGE TYPE DYNAMOMETER Fig.1 simple 2 component cutting force dynamometer for use on a lethe

MECHANICAL DIAL GAUGE TYPE DYNAMOMETER  Fig 1 shows a simple tyoe of 2 component force dynamometer, where the cutting tool is supported at the end of cantilever.  The vertical and horizontal components of the deflection of the cantilever under the action of the resultant tool force are taken as a measure of the two force component,i.e. Ft & Fr.  The dial gauge A gives a measure of cutting force (Ft) and dial gauge B gives a measure of thrust force(Fr).  The two components Ft & Fr of the resultant tool force measured with a dynamometer, may be used to calculate many important variable in the process if continuous chip formation.

STRAIN GUAGE DYNAMOMETER Fig:2 Resistance strain gauge type dynamometer

STRAIN GUAGE DYNAMOMETER  In orthogonal or two dimensional cutting,the resultant force applied to the chip by the tool is usually determined,in experimental work,from the measurement of two orthogonal component: 1.Cutting force Ft or Fc 2.Thrust force Fr  Fig 2 shows two component electrical strain gauge dynamometer.  It consists of two half ring arranged to support the cutting tool, the flat sides serving to simplify the problem of mounting the strain gauge on the ring.  An electrical strain gauge is essentially a wound length of resistance wire (0.025 mm dia) duly enveloped

 The strain gauge is bounded with adhesive onto the surface under investigation.The resistance of wire is increased by stretching due to the direct increase in length.  If the surfaceis compressed, wire length also compresses and the resistance of wire is decreased.This change in resistance of the strain guage is measured by a Wheatstone bridge.  Formulae are available to convert these reading into change in length,strain and hence stresses to which surface or strain gauges were subjected.  Two sets of strain gauge,connected in two separate Wheatstone bridges are mounted as follows.

 To measure the vertical component of the applied force,gauge 1 to 4 are mounted on the horizontal centre line of the ring ; when a vertical laod is applied,gauges 1 & 3 will record compressive strain and gauge 2 & 4 record tensile strain.
